Frank Lloyd Wright Quotes
A free America... means just this: individual freedom for all, rich or poor, or else this system of government we call democracy is only an expedient to enslave man to the machine and make him like it.
God is the great mysterious motivator of what we call nature, and it has often been said by philosophers, that nature is the will of God. And I prefer to say that nature is the only body of God that we shall ever see.
Eventually, I think Chicago will be the most beautiful great city left in the world.
Early in life I had to choose between honest arrogance and hypocritical humility. I chose the former and have seen no reason to change.
New York City is a great monument to the power of money and greed... a race for rent.
Every great architect is - necessarily - a great poet. He must be a great original interpreter of his time, his day, his age.
Respect the masterpiece. It is true reverence to man. There is no quality so great, none so much needed now.
The present is the ever moving shadow that divides yesterday from tomorrow. In that lies hope.
